Glint is a video effects camera for iOS that uses on-device person segmentation to apply real-time overlays and green-screen effects.

Key features

Real-time Person Segmentationedge

Uses on-device detection to isolate the user from the background for live effect application at 60 FPS

Green Screen Effectsedge

Replaces backgrounds with custom images or solid colors from the camera roll in real time

Creative Effect Librarystandard

Includes 20 total effects such as overlays, distortions, and color shifts applied live to video or photo

How much does it cost?

freemiumFree tier with 5 real-time effectsPremium unlock for $4.99 one-time payment

Monetization relies on a single $4.99 purchase to unlock the full feature set, avoiding recurring subscription costs.

FAQ

Is Glint a subscription app?
No, Glint uses a one-time $4.99 purchase model to unlock all features, avoiding recurring subscription charges.
Does Glint require an internet connection to process effects?
No, Glint performs all person segmentation and effect application on-device at 60 FPS, meaning no cloud processing or upload queue is required.
How does Glint compare to other video editors?
Glint focuses on real-time, on-device effects for immediate capture, whereas many other editors rely on cloud processing or post-production editing workflows.
